In this powerful episode of The Master The NEC Podcast, Paul Abernathy breaks down the essential steps every electrician needs to take to build a recognizable, respected local electrical brand.

Whether you're a solo master electrician or running a growing electrical contracting business, branding isn't just about logos—it's about how your community sees you, trusts you, and calls you first when they need the job done right.

You'll learn:
✅ How to define your identity and stand out from the crowd
✅ The visual branding elements that build credibility
✅ Must-have digital tools like Google Business and social media
✅ How customer experience fuels your reputation
✅ Proven methods for earning 5-star reviews
✅ Community involvement strategies that build trust
✅ Ways to educate your audience and establish authority
✅ How to stay consistent and grow your brand long-term
